Given :
Money Katie has, M = $30.
She has found a bracelet with a regular price of $45 and a discount of 35%.
The sales tax is 7%.
To Find :
Will she have enough to buy the bracelet.
Solution :
Original price = $45 .
Price after discount = $( 45 - 45×0.35) = $29.25 .
Selling Price = $( 29.25 + 29.25×0.07 ) = $31.2975 .
Since, selling price is greater than $30.
Money needed = $( 31.2975 - 30 ) = $1.2975 .
Therefore, Katie will not buy the bracelet.
